Thin navel piercings have become a popular form of body art, providing a unique way to express personal style. These piercings are generally made with a thin barbell or ring that fits snugly and comfortably in the navel, allowing for a variety of decorative options. Whether you're considering a thin navel piercing for the first time or looking to change your existing jewelry, it's important to understand the nuances of this body modification.
- **Comfort:** A thin design often means less irritation and a more comfortable fit.
- **Style Variety:** There are countless designs available, from simple metallic pieces to intricate gems and charms.
- **Healing Process:** Like any piercing, proper care is essential to ensure a speedy and healthy healing process.
When selecting jewelry for your thin navel piercing, look for options made from high-quality materials such as surgical steel, titanium, or gold to minimize the risk of irritation or infection. It's also advisable to consult with a professional piercer to ensure that the jewelry fits well and is appropriate for your specific anatomy. Remember, the right choice can enhance your look and provide a comfortable experience.
Additionally, keeping your piercing clean and following aftercare instructions can help prevent complications. With the right care, your thin navel piercing can be a stunning accessory for years to come.
